What is Fatty Liver Disease?
Fatty liver disease occurs when fat accumulates in the liver, which is responsible for processing fats and detoxifying the body. While it is normal for the liver to have a small amount of fat, excessive fat buildup can lead to liver inflammation and damage over time.
There are two primary types of fatty liver disease:
- Non-Alcoholic Fatty Liver Disease (NAFLD): The most common form, usually associated with obesity, diabetes, and high cholesterol.
- Alcoholic Fatty Liver Disease (AFLD): Caused by excessive alcohol consumption.
Both types can progress into more severe liver conditions, including liver cirrhosis and liver failure, if not managed properly. Seeking fatty liver treatment early can prevent complications and improve liver health.
Causes of Fatty Liver Disease
Several factors can contribute to the development of fatty liver disease, including:
- Obesity: Excess fat in the body can lead to fat buildup in the liver.
- Poor Diet: A high-fat, high-sugar diet can contribute to liver fat accumulation.
- Diabetes: High blood sugar levels can increase fat deposits in the liver.
- High Cholesterol: Elevated cholesterol levels can affect liver function and fat metabolism.
- Excessive Alcohol Consumption: Drinking alcohol in large quantities can cause inflammation and fat buildup in the liver.
- Medications: Certain drugs can lead to liver damage, contributing to fatty liver disease.
Symptoms of Fatty Liver Disease
In the early stages, fatty liver disease often doesn’t show any symptoms. However, as the condition progresses, you may notice:
- Fatigue: Feeling unusually tired or weak.
- Abdominal discomfort: A dull pain or fullness in the upper right side of the abdomen.
- Unexplained weight loss: Losing weight without any effort.
- Yellowing of the skin or eyes: Jaundice can occur if liver function worsens.
- Swollen abdomen or legs: Fluid buildup due to liver dysfunction.

Fatty Liver Treatment: How to Manage the Condition Effectively
The good news is that fatty liver treatment can often help reverse the condition, especially in the early stages. The goal is to reduce fat accumulation in the liver, prevent further liver damage, and improve overall liver function. Below are some of the most effective approaches for treating fatty liver disease:
1. Lifestyle Modifications
One of the most effective fatty liver treatments is making lifestyle changes:
-
Healthy Diet: Focus on a balanced diet that includes plenty of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ins. Reducing the intake of fatty foods, sugars, and refined carbohydrates can help reduce liver fat. A liver-healthy diet is key to reversing fatty liver.
-
Weight Loss: Losing even a small amount of weight can significantly reduce fat in the liver. Aim for a gradual weight loss of 1-2 pounds per week to avoid liver stress.
-
Exercise: Regular physical activity helps burn fat and reduces liver fat.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ise most days of the week.
2. Medications for Fatty Liver Treatment
In some cases, medications may be necessary to manage fatty liver disease, especially if it is caused by underlying conditions such as diabetes or high cholesterol. These may include:
-
Insulin Sensitizers: Medications like metformin can help improve insulin sensitivity and reduce liver fat in patients with NAFLD.
-
Cholesterol-Lowering Drugs: Statins or other lipid-lowering medications can help control cholesterol levels, preventing further liver damage.
-
Vitamin E: In certain cases, vitamin E supplements may help reduce liver inflammation, especially in non-alcoholic fatty liver disease.
3. Management of Underlying Conditions
Managing underlying conditions is an essential part of fatty liver treatment. For example, controlling high blood pressure, diabetes, and high cholesterol can prevent further fat buildup in the liver. Regular checkups and blood tests can help monitor these conditions and guide treatment.
4. Avoid Alcohol and Toxins
For individuals with alcoholic fatty liver disease (AFLD), the most effective treatment is to stop drinking alcohol completely. Even moderate alcohol consumption can worsen liver damage. Additionally, avoiding exposure to toxins and medications that may harm the liver is crucial in managing fatty liver disease.
5. Liver Transplantation
In severe cases of liver cirrhosis or liver failure due to fatty liver disease, a liver transplant may be required. However, this is considered a last resort when other treatments have not been effective.
